New Delhi: The Union Cabinet on Wednesday approved ₹15,000 crore for what it calls 'India COVID-19 Emergency Response and Health System Preparedness Package'.
The funds will be utilized in 3 phases while for immediate COVID-19 emergency response, provision of an amount of ₹7,774 crore has been kept.
Meanwhile the rest of the amount will be used for medium-term support for the next 1-4 years, which will be provided under the mission mode approach, said the government on Wednesday.
